Welcome to Bryce Resort – your family’s winter wonderland! Start your perfect winter day at Bryce with breakfast at the Shenandoah Center. The grill opens when the lift’s bull wheel starts turning. Warm up before heading out with coffee for mom and dad, and hot chocolate for the kiddos.

 

Once everyone is warm and full, drop the kids off at the Horst Locker Snowsports school. Take advantage of their two-hour lesson, so you can make some runs and explore the trails. Whether you need a break or waiting for the kids’ lesson to end, grab beverage at Carter’s Hutte, the Resort’s slope-side bar. Get warm by the firepits and make some new friends! Most don’t realize that Bryce Resort is a member-owned and managed, so you’ll find members welcoming and happy to share stories about their favorite ski runs.

 

After you make a run or two to see what the kids learned, pop back into the Shenandoah Center for a quick lunch before your Snow Tubing reservation. Tubing sessions are 90 minutes of family fun (height restrictions apply. Do the kids still have energy to burn? Then take them ice skating at the conveniently-located, family friendly ice rink. It’s even available as an “add on” to your snow tubing ticket.

 

Relax after skiing with dinner at the Copper Kettle, the Resort’s fully renovated slope-side bar & restaurant. Enjoy good drinks, good food and hot chocolate. Reservations are required via Open Table for those wishing to dine at a table; however, reservations are not required for bar seating – if you can find an empty stool.
